POSITION SUMMARY

The executive assistant to the Head of School provides consistent, confidential, and professional administrative support for the Head of School in order to maintain the well-being of the school and the broader community. The executive assistant to the head plays an integral role in the day-to-day goings on of the administrative team, faculty, and the student body. This individual will be the first line of communication between the Head of School and the wider community.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Manage and strategically prioritize the Head of School’s daily workflow, schedule, and complex calendar activities, making independent decisions to resolve conflicts and manage demands from internal and external stakeholders.
  • Serve as the Head of School’s primary gatekeeper, proactively addressing inquiries, resolving complex issues, and directing information flow to ensure the Head's focus remains on strategic leadership.
  • Assist the Head of School with work and events related to the board of directors
  • Manage the full lifecycle of Board meetings and committees, including developing agendas in coordination with the Head and Board Chair, distributing sensitive meeting materials (e.g., board packets, financial reports), attending after-hours meetings, and recording and maintaining official board minutes and corporate records
  • Effectively manages projects, looking ahead to plan for BPC’s operational needs, and facilitates the successful execution of initiatives
  • Meet with the board chair on a weekly basis
  • Attend and assist in board-related events beyond board meetings such as the board retreat, Major Donor Party, other donor events, etc.
  • Manage school calendars, ensuring accurate scheduling of school events
  • Make school-related travel arrangements for the Head of School
  • Manage expenses for the Head of School
  • Serve as a liaison between the Head of School and other constituents, requiring high-level discretion and confidentiality.
  • Manage arrangements, including catering, for all-school faculty / staff meetings and employee events
  • Oversee set up for board meetings : facilities, technology, catering, etc
  • Share in planning campus-wide events
  • Assist in organizing new-staff and faculty orientation for the start of the school year
  • Compile information as requested, for the Head of School
  • Manage and serve as a liaison for school memberships, such as CAIS, NAIS, etc.
  • Manage outside contractors with renting facility spaces
  • Obtain, gather, and organize pertinent data for Federal, State, and District reports and surveys
  • Maintain administrative building office, kitchen, and hospitality supplies
  • Plan, coordinate, and manage arrangements (logistics, technology, catering) for meetings and all-school events, often exercising independent judgment regarding resource allocation and execution.
  • Promote the school’s mission and values, ensuring they are central to all operational and policy decisions
  • Support an atmosphere of trust and openness among teachers, students, and parents
